Angry Accident Repair Hell

So I bought my wife a brand new 19 G05 and only just 3 weeks after some guy decided it was a good idea to illegally cut into the HOV and hit our brand new suv. Thankfully they had insurance, but it's a very shady one at best. It took a month for us to even get it into the shop with my dealer. Now the dealer is telling me they cannot find a single part and thus cannot return our vehicle. It's some sort of fender bracket he said. He informed us that his system states it won't be in stock until NOVEMBER. I don't know what i can do right now, we are without a 2nd car and have to carpool everywhere. On top of all that my wife is pregnant in her third trimester and is quite uncomfortable in my M4. What can I do? Could this be classified as a lemon? It took 3 weeks to build AND deliver this car, so I cannot for the life of my understand why it would take 3 months to repair. Any ideas are appreciated.


Edit: Overall very happy with how safe the X5 is. The guys truck and another car both got totaled while this thing took it like a champ. 18K repair however

Forgot to mention, we chose to not get rental because we assumed it shouldn't take that long and we could get a "loss of use" check instead. On top of that, insurance will only cover 30 days, even when not at fault. I've asked them to provide a loaner and the dealer has stated they are not allowed to. I agree this doesn't sound like a lemon, but if they cannot repair it in under 30 days i was thinking maybe it fits under that part of the statute for Texas. I'll try contacting BMW NA to see if there is something they can do.

PS: Cost is so high because of the LED headlight (base LED is $3750, $5500 for laser) and also because of a driving sensor $4000 (only the size of a standard bifold)

guys, lemon law applies to manufacturer defects not accidents. it's not something you want to throw around because from experience lemon law is very tricky and hard even in the best cases.
